Charity golf tournament polos are a unique ordering category: large quantity, tight lead times, multiple embroidery placements for sponsors, and wild size variance across attendees. This guide walks through how to spec, order, and distribute tournament polos for events of 50 to 500 players.

A great charity tournament polo does three things at once: makes players feel the event is well-run, gives sponsors real visual equity, and ends up in players' regular rotation afterward (so the brand keeps traveling). Cheap tournament polos do none of these things. They get worn once and donated.

The Tournament Polo Specification

Fabric 180-210 gsm performance poly blend
UV protection UPF 30+ rating for 4+ hour sun exposure
Moisture management Moisture-wicking, quick-dry finish
Event logo Left chest, embroidered, 2.5-3 cm
Sponsor placements Right chest + left sleeve (tiered sponsor visibility)
Size spread XS through 4XL, men's & women's cuts
Lead time 6 weeks standard, 3 weeks express for 150+ orders

Sponsor Placement Strategy

Lead sponsor goes on the left chest at 7-9 cm wide; secondary sponsors on the sleeve and back yoke keep the front uncluttered.

Sponsors pay for visibility. A tournament polo has four embroidery slots, each with different value tiers.

  • Left chest (prime): Event master logo. This is never a sponsor placement.
  • Right chest: Top-tier title sponsor. Most expensive real estate.
  • Left sleeve: Mid-tier sponsor. Visible when the player swings, particularly in broadcast.
  • Right sleeve: Lower-tier sponsor or event host club.
  • Back yoke: Reserved for printed-on-demand sponsor rotations year-over-year.

Ordering Timeline

The 12-week timeline gives buffer for sponsor sign-up, mockup approval, and on-time delivery before tournament day.
  1. 12 weeks out: Confirm sponsor tiers and collect sponsor logos in vector format.
  2. 10 weeks out: Approve the polo design, color, and embroidery layout. Get a sew-out proof.
  3. 8 weeks out: Lock the size breakdown. Send size registration to all confirmed players.
  4. 6 weeks out: Place the bulk order. Production begins.
  5. 2 weeks out: Polos arrive. Sort into named bags by player.
  6. Event day: Distribute at registration. Reserve 10% extra across sizes for walk-ins.
Key Takeaways for Tournament Directors

Running a tournament polo program

  • Performance fabric, not cotton. Golf is a 4+ hour sweaty sport under full sun. Cotton dies.
  • Embroider, don't print. Sponsors see embroidery as premium. Screen-print reads cheap.
  • Order 10% spare inventory. Size mis-registrations happen. Walk-ins happen. Plan for it.
  • Start 12 weeks early. Tournament polo programs collapse when rushed.
